Massive iceberg capsizes off the coast of Greenland A massive iceberg capsized off the coast of Ilulissat, Greenland, on July 25, flipping with force to reveal its jagged underside amid a burst of waves and mist. The spectacle took place near the UNESCO-listed Ilulissat Icefjord, with no injuries reported.
